📜  HTML |<object>边框属性(1)

📅  最后修改于: 2023-12-03 14:41:52.969000             🧑  作者: Mango

HTML <object> 边框属性

HTML <object> 元素用于嵌入外部资源(如图像、视频、音频、Flash 动画等)到网页中。边框属性是 <object> 元素的一个可选属性,用于指定嵌入资源的边框样式。

语法

下面是 <object> 元素的边框属性的语法:

<object data="url" border="pixels"></object>
  • data:指定要嵌入的外部资源的 URL。
  • border:指定边框的宽度,可以是像素值或者是默认的 1
示例
<object data="example.jpg" border="3"></object>

上面的示例将会在页面上嵌入一个边框宽度为 3 像素的图像。

注意事项
  • 边框属性只适用于使用 <object> 元素嵌入的非 HTML 内容,如图像、Flash 动画等。对于嵌入 HTML 内容,可以通过 CSS 样式来指定边框样式。
  • 边框属性在 HTML5 中已废弃,推荐使用 CSS 来控制元素的外观,包括边框样式。
替代方案

为了实现更灵活的边框样式控制,推荐使用 CSS 来控制嵌入内容的边框。通过定义类或 ID,可以轻松地为 <object> 元素添加和调整边框属性,如下所示:

<style>
    .object-border {
        border: 1px solid black;
        padding: 10px;
    }
</style>

<object data="example.swf" class="object-border"></object>

通过上面的示例,我们可以给嵌入的 Flash 动画添加一个边框并设置内边距,以实现更丰富的界面效果。

总结

边框属性可用于为使用 <object> 元素嵌入的非 HTML 内容添加简单的边框样式。但是,由于该属性已经被废弃,更推荐使用 CSS 来控制元素的外观和边框样式,以实现更灵活的界面设计。